The real estate in the UK is coming out of the period of recession. House prices are rising and so are the challenges for those looking for first time buyer mortgage. However, the inflated house prices are not restraining people from trying for their first mortgage loan. Mortgage industry has become competitive and the first time home buyers can try different and flexible mortgage products available. Here are some good tips that can help you in this direction.Deciding the Mortgage DepositMortgage deposit is the amount a lender expects from the mortgage borrower to contribute in the purchase of a house. Unfortunately, the deposits expected by the mortgage lenders after facing recession period have become larger than before. However, arranging for the large deposit can obviously enhance the chances of getting a good mortgage plan. It is good if you rely upon your parents or other family members to secure the required deposit for you.Joint MortgagesThe concept of joint mortgages works if you are able to find someone with a wish to invest in the property you are eying at. This can help you share the purchasing prices and the burden of mortgage loans. However, it is better to have someone known to share the property with. Shared ownership should not turn out to be a daunting experience in the long run.Mortgage for Self EmployedSelf employed individuals are often considered to be at risk by the potential mortgage lenders. Preference is given to those with a regular source of income through a regular job. However, self-employed people have a solution in the form of self certification mortgage. Using this, an individual can obtain mortgage loan by certifying the income he or she claims to earn through their business. As obvious, this type of mortgage has higher rate of interest and require the borrower to make a higher deposit.Self Certification Mortgage is often considered as a temporary solution by a borrower to at least get into the housing market. Once he or she establishes reputation, switching to other mortgage plans with better interest rates become easy.Some Other TipsConsider buying an Interest-Only Mortgage plan if you expect your income to expand in the future. This arrangement helps by allowing lower monthly repayments in the beginning. If possible, you can consider relocating to a place with better prospects of obtaining First Time Buyer Mortgage.Buying home mortgage to own a house is always better than paying the rent.
